setup for Site Report Analysis
can any one tell me what should be the correct inputs to get a site report? (no. of people who visited the site, Top users, Top sites...etc)What I currently have is:from Central administration-->Operatoins --> Usage Analysis ProcessingEnable Usage Analysis processing (Checked)Run processing between these times daily:Start: 1 amEnd: 1 pmand for the scheduling: from central administration --> operations --> information management policy usage reportEnable recuring policy usage report (Checked)DailyBetween: 1 Am To 2 AMAre those settings are correct?!

Hi Aysha,also , you need to Enable usage reporting through SSP admin page, then you need to must activate the reporting feature through site collection,for more details steps, plz, read the following articlehttp://technet.microsoft.com/en-us/library/cc262541.aspxBest Regrads, Ahmed Madany

the usage reporting in SSP is enabled alreadyfrom where can i activate the reporting feature in the site collection?I can get the report of a site but the figures and numbers displayed are incorrect (i guess!!)for example: it says the the distinct users yesterday = 15!! which is unbelievable... the site is accessed daily by all employee (over 1000!!)Is the problem with the start and end time that i entered in the enable usage analysis processing?!!

HI,-To activate Reporting feature, go to site collection features -> activate reporting feature.- while enabling recuring policy usage report , you (Checked) Daily, then put values ( Between: ) say 8Am to 5 Pm working day hour .Best Regrads, Ahmed Madany
